Comprehending Audi Keys
Audi, like lots of modern car brands, has actually moved beyond conventional mechanical keys to utilize advanced key fobs and keyless entry systems. Understanding the kind of key you have will help in understanding what actions to consider a replacement. Here are the main types of keys commonly utilized in Audi cars:

Traditional Metal Key: Some older Audi models still use standard metal keys, which can be duplicated at any locksmith professional or hardware shop.

Transponder Key: Most Audi cars produced after the 1990s come geared up with transponder keys. These keys consist of a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system to allow beginning. An unique programming treatment is needed for replacement.

Key Fob: Many newer Audi designs feature key fobs that incorporate keyless entry and push-button start functions. Replacement usually involves both physical key duplication and electronic programming.

Smart Key/ Keyless Entry System: The newest designs typically include wise keys enabling for proximity entry. These keys can be more intricate and usually must be bought through a dealer or certified locksmith.
Steps to Replace an Audi Car Key
If you've lost audi keys your Audi car key or require a replacement, follow these steps to make sure a smooth procedure:

Determine the Key Type: Identify the type of key your Audi utilizes. Examine the lorry handbook or consult with the dealership if unsure.

Find Your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): Your VIN, generally discovered on the chauffeur's side control panel or door frame, will be required for validating ownership and purchasing a key.

Contact Your Audi Dealer: Visit or call your authorized Audi dealership for replacement options. They will require proof of ownership (typically your chauffeur's license and car registration) to process a new key.

Alternative Locksmith Services: If you're looking for a more hassle-free and possibly economical alternative, seek out a local vehicle locksmith who specializes in key fob and transponder key programming. Make sure they are licensed and geared up to handle Audi keys.

Budget for Costs: Be ready for the costs associated with replacing an Audi key, which might vary based on its type and the entity supplying the service. Normal expenses are as follows:
Traditional key: ₤ 10-₤ 50Transponder key: ₤ 100-₤ 300Key fob: ₤ 200-₤ 600Smart key: ₤ 200-₤ 800
Program the New Key: After obtaining a replacement, whether through the dealership or locksmith professional, the new key will likely require to be programmed to your car. This process is necessary for transponder and wise keys to function correctly.
DIY Key Replacement: A Word of Caution
While lots of might be lured to turn to online guideline guides, it's critical to acknowledge that DIY replacements can be risky. Modern Audi keys and their programming generally require customized devices and software. Trying a DIY procedure without the correct knowledge and tools might result in further problems or even harm the lorry's electronic systems.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Is it pricey to change an Audi car key?
The cost to change an Audi car key varies depending on the key type and service approach. It normally varies from ₤ 10 for standard keys to as high as ₤ 800 for clever keys.
2. Can I make a copy of my Audi key at any locksmith professional?
Not all locksmiths are geared up to handle intricate key fob or transponder key duplication. It is advisable to look for locksmith professionals who specialize in vehicle keys, or call your Audi dealer for key duplication.
3. Is my Audi key covered under guarantee?
Audi's automobile service warranty might cover issues associated with key malfunctions, but lost or stolen keys generally are not covered. Consult your service warranty documents for specifics.
4. The length of time does it take to get a replacement key?
The time it takes to receive a replacement key can vary. If purchased through a dealership, it may take several days to weeks, while a local locksmith professional may have the ability to supply a new audi car key key practically instantly, depending upon stock and intricacy.
5. Can I configure a new key myself?
Programming a new key normally requires specific devices. While some aftermarket tools exist, it is usually suggested to look for professional help to guarantee the key runs properly.
